Figuren in der Zusammenfassung von Der Gesang der Flusskrebse

  • Kya ClarkThe 'Marsh Girl' who survives alone in the wild
  • PaKya's alcoholic father who eventually abandons her
  • JodieKya's beloved brother who is the last to leave
  • Jumpin'Owner of a Gas and Bait shop who helps Kya
  • Tate WalkerKya's first love who teaches her to read

Über den Autor

Über den Autor von Der Gesang der Flusskrebse

Delia Owens, die gefeierte amerikanische Autorin und Naturschützerin, ist vor allem für ihren Bestseller-Roman Der Gesang der Flusskrebse bekannt, eine eindringliche Mischung aus Kriminalroman und Coming-of-Age-Drama, die in den Marschen von North Carolina spielt.

Basierend auf ihrer jahrzehntelangen Karriere als Wildtierbiologin in Afrika verleiht Owens dem Roman reiche ökologische Details und erforscht Themen wie Isolation, Resilienz und die Verbindung des Menschen zur Natur. Sie ist Mitautorin von drei preisgekrönten Sachbüchern – Der Ruf der Kalahari, Das Auge des Elefanten und Secrets of the Savanna –, in denen sie ihre bahnbrechende Forschung über Hyänen, Löwen und Elefanten dokumentiert.

Owens, die an der UC Davis in Tierverhalten promovierte, veröffentlichte ihre Arbeiten unter anderem in Nature und dem African Journal of Ecology und wurde mit dem John Burroughs Award für Naturerzählungen ausgezeichnet. Der Gesang der Flusskrebse hat sich weltweit über 12 Millionen Mal verkauft und wurde 2022 als großer Kinofilm adaptiert.
